The P51178-B21 Broadcom BCM5719 Ethernet 1Gb 4-port BASE-T Adapter for HPE is a highly reliable, enterprise-grade networking solution designed to meet the continuous data demands of modern high-density computing environments. Featuring a quad-port configuration over standard copper cabling, this network interface card (NIC) enables comprehensive bandwidth aggregation and robust port failover capabilities directly within enterprise server infrastructure.
Engineered to provide stable, low-latency Gigabit Ethernet connectivity, this adapter is an essential component for virtualization, cloud computing, and high-transaction database workloads. By incorporating specialized hardware-assisted processing, it offloads critical network protocol tasks from the host CPU, optimizing overall server performance and allowing compute resources to be fully dedicated to primary application workloads.
This networking asset utilizes a high-bandwidth PCI Express (PCIe) interface designed to prevent internal data bus bottlenecks, ensuring synchronous bi-directional communication across all four physical ports. The utilization of standard BASE-T RJ-45 copper connectors permits immediate integration into existing Category 5e (or higher) structured cabling frameworks, drastically reducing infrastructural migration costs.
The multi-port layout provides system architects with flexibility to segment network traffic into distinct operational zones, such as isolating management traffic, virtual machine migration channels, and standard production data lines. Enhanced security and monitoring features are deeply integrated into the device firmware, protecting against unauthorized modifications and ensuring accurate data telemetry.
The four independent ports permit network engineers to execute NIC teaming configurations, combining physical lines into a singular logical path for throughput optimization. In the event of a switch port or physical cable failure, the adapter automatically routes communication through the remaining functional links without disrupting active virtual machines.
Yes, the BASE-T copper standard natively features backward compatibility. While Category 5e or Category 6 cabling is recommended to achieve sustained 1Gbps speeds across a maximum distance of 100 meters, it can operate efficiently on standard existing copper setups.
